Training because you love pole and training with the goal of putting a complete routine on stage are two very different things.
Suddenly, you’re not just learning tricks or a chorey from your instructor.
You’re thinking about a routine concept, combo ideas, stamina, run throughs, recovery, costume and wtf is X factor?
Your training volume may increase. You’re repeating the same movements more often and you’re trying to make difficult things look effortless (usually whilst you’re super tired).
And when those demands increase, preparing your body properly matters.
How do you structure your training?
How much strength and conditioning should you be doing alongside pole?
How many attempts should you be making?
There is A LOT to think about, especially for your first competition. And there are plenty of things you simply don’t know that you don’t know yet.
